Versi dokumen orisinil: Weekly development report as of 2024-02-02
Dipublikasikan pada tanggal 02 Februari 2024
Ditulis oleh Olga Hryniuk
Terjemahan ke dalam Bahasa Indonesia oleh @andreassosilo
(Translated to Indonesian language by @andreassosilo)
Laporan pengembangan mingguan per 02-02-2024
02 Februari 2024 | Olga Hryniuk
TEKNOLOGI INTI
Minggu ini, tim DB Sync mempersiapkan dan menguji versi baru db-sync
untuk mainnet dan terus mengintegrasikan fungsi Conway sambil memperluas modularitasnya.
Seperti biasa, lihat laporan pengembangan teknis ini untuk detail lebih lanjut dari berbagai tim.
SMART CONTRACT
Minggu ini, tim Marlowe terus bekerja pada marlowe-cardano
dengan membuat proses non-SRE untuk menjalankan benchmark untuk meningkatkan evaluasi kinerja, menggunakan state yang disediakan saat menjalankan analisis keamanan, dan menyelesaikan referensi Wolfram oracle. Mereka juga melakukan profil Marlowe Runtime untuk optimasi dan menggabungkan repositori real-world-marlowe dan marlowe-hackathons ke dalam folder kontrak. Tim tersebut menghapus beberapa modul – marlowe-streamer
, marlowe-signing
, marlowe-scaling
, dan marlowe-finder
(komit: 1, 2, 3) – sebagai bagian dari upaya proyek. Selain itu, tim menilai kelayakan mendukung CIP yang memiliki dampak besar untuk memprioritaskan upaya pengembangan masa depan, menguji waktu sinkronisasi baik Marlowe indexer maupun chain indexer untuk optimasi kinerja, memperbarui dokumen keamanan Marlowe dengan hash script terbaru dan dokumen developer CF sesuai untuk memastikan kepatuhan keamanan. Tim menambahkan dokumentasi komprehensif untuk role token dan membuat video tutorial yang menjelaskan token peran dan peran terbuka untuk pemahaman dan adopsi yang lebih baik.
Terakhir, mereka membuat tes untuk kontrak pertukaran atomik dan melakukan pengecekan di Marlowe Playground untuk memastikan kontrak tidak mencampur alamat mainnet dan testnet.
SCALING
Minggu ini, tim Hydra melaksanakan sesi perencanaan jangka panjang tahunan, memperkenalkan perubahan API untuk menghilangkan penyandian JSON dari transaksi, menyelesaikan implementasi logika off-chain untuk incremental decommit, dan mengimplementasikan sebuah hydra-explorer
backend. Baca laporan bulanan Januari di sini.
Tim Mithril terus melaksanakan implementasi jenis data baru untuk mengesahkan transaksi Cardano dalam jaringan Mithril. Mereka menyelesaikan penandatanganan set transaksi dan mengimplementasikan rute agregator, yang bertanggung jawab atas pembuatan bukti keanggotaan untuk daftar transaksi Cardano. Selain itu, mereka menyelesaikan alur kerja manual untuk menguji paket klien NPM di CI dan meningkatkan ketangguhan dalam menghitung daftar file tak berubah dalam database node Cardano. Tim juga memperluas cakupan end-to-end test di CI untuk menyesuaikan dengan beberapa versi node Cardano dan berbagai skenario hard fork.
Terakhir, mereka menyelesaikan peningkatan komunikasi node yang lebih baik antara Mithril dan Cardano untuk mengambil UTXO dan terus bekerja pada threat modeling dan analisa risiko untuk jaringan P2P.
VOLTAIRE & SANCHONET
Minggu ini, tim mengembangkan fitur Conway penting, yang memungkinkan operator stake pool untuk memberikan suara pada pembaruan parameter protokol yang relevan dengan keamanan tertentu. Mereka juga mengatur hierarki proposal dan mengujinya untuk akurasi dan efektivitas.
Selain itu, tim memperbaiki beberapa bug penting:
- Memperbaiki masalah yang memungkinkan anggota komite konstitusi memberikan suara pada tindakan tata kelola yang seharusnya tidak mereka akses.
- Melaksanakan perlindungan untuk mencegah deposit muncul di akun imbalan yang terpisah setelah kredensial staking tidak terdaftar tetapi sebelum deposit prosedur proposal telah dikembalikan.
- Memastikan bahwa
Sets
dienkripsi dalam CBOR dengantag 258
secara default.
Intersect MBO juga mengadakan pemungutan suara untuk pengaturan parameter CIP-1694, dan komite parameter tata kelola mencari masukan dari komunitas untuk menentukan pengaturan awalnya. Pelajari lebih lanjut di sini.
CATALYST
Minggu ini, Project Catalyst memasuki minggu kedua pemungutan suara di Fund11. Secara kolektif, hampir 5.000 dompet telah memberikan lebih dari 150.000 suara atas 920 proposal yang mencari pendanaan komunitas. Hal ini merupakan bukti luar biasa akan keinginan yang didorong oleh komunitas untuk mendanai inovasi di Cardano. Jika Anda adalah pemilih terdaftar di Fund11, Anda dapat memberikan suara terakhir Anda hingga 8 Februari, pukul 11 pagi UTC. Hasil diharapkan akan keluar sekitar 15 Februari.
Tanggal 4 Februari juga merupakan kesempatan terakhir untuk mendaftar menjalankan working group Catalyst. Baca posting blog ini untuk mempelajari lebih lanjut tentang konsepnya.
Dalam berita lain, komunitas juga mengadakan town hall keempat tahun ini. Sekali lagi, pemilihan proyek-proyek yang baru selesai diperlihatkan serta pembaruan terbaru dari Tim Catalyst. Pertemuan berikutnya dijadwalkan pada minggu berikutnya dan kemudian setiap Rabu berikutnya, selalu pada pukul 5 sore UTC. Anda dapat mendaftar di sini.
EDUKASI
Tim edukasi sedang merencanakan iterasi kedua dari kursus pelatihan developer Cardano bekerja sama dengan Africa Blockchain Center (ABC). Mereka juga terus memperbarui pelajaran-pelajaran lanjutan dari kursus Haskell Bootcamp.